How to Measure This Angle on an Image or Photo
International Residential Code (IRC) recommends stair angles between 30° and 37°. For a standard 7-inch rise and 10-inch run, the stringer angle is arctan(7/10) = 34.99 degrees. Verify existing stairs or architectural drawings using photo angle overlay.
